About Ne-Yo: A Modern-Day King of R&B

Shaffer Chimere Smith, known to the world as Ne-Yo, has cemented his status as a true architect of modern R&B. His journey to stardom wasn't an overnight sensation, but rather a testament to persistent talent and a keen understanding of the genre. Initially gaining recognition as a gifted songwriter, Ne-Yo penned Mario's 2004 smash hit "Let Me Love You," a breakthrough that showcased his lyrical prowess and ability to craft emotionally resonant narratives. This success paved the way for his own recording career, and in 2006, he exploded onto the scene with his debut album, In My Own Words. The album, featuring the chart-topping single "So Sick," immediately established Ne-Yo as a formidable artist with a unique blend of classic soul sensibilities and contemporary pop sensibilities.

Ne-Yo's musical style is characterized by his velvety smooth tenor, introspective and relatable lyrics, and a knack for infectious melodies. Over the years, his sound has evolved, incorporating elements of hip-hop and dance music while always remaining true to his R&B roots. Albums like Because of You (2007) and Year of the Gentleman (2008) further solidified his commercial success and critical acclaim, earning him multiple Grammy Awards and nominations. Beyond his solo work, Ne-Yo has also been a prolific songwriter and producer for other artists, further contributing to the sonic landscape of popular music. Dos Equis Pavilion: The Perfect Setting for a Soulful Soirée

Nestled within the sprawling Fair Park in Dallas, Texas, the Dos Equis Pavilion stands as a venerable institution for live music. Originally known as the Starplex Amphitheatre, it first opened its gates in 1988, quickly establishing itself as a premier destination for major touring acts. With a generous capacity of over 20,000, the pavilion is perfectly equipped to handle the energy of a Ne-Yo concert, offering both reserved seating and a vast lawn area, ensuring a dynamic viewing experience for every fan. Its open-air design, particularly the iconic roof structure, provides a unique atmosphere, allowing the music to soar under the Texan sky, while also offering some shelter from the elements.

The venue’s location within Fair Park, a National Historic Landmark, adds a touch of cultural significance to any event held there. Getting to Dos Equis Pavilion: Your Dallas Transport Navigator

Navigating your way to the Dos Equis Pavilion for Ne-Yo’s performance is straightforward, with several accessible transport options available. Dallas boasts a robust public transportation system, making it easy to reach Fair Park, home of the pavilion.

By Train: The nearest light rail station is Fair Park Station, serviced by the Green Line. This line offers convenient connections from various points across the city, including Downtown Dallas. The journey time will vary depending on your starting point, but from the downtown core, expect approximately a 15-20 minute ride. From Fair Park Station, the Dos Equis Pavilion is a short, well-signposted walk.

By Tube/Metro: Dallas uses the light rail system, essentially its "metro." As mentioned, the Green Line is your primary route to Fair Park Station. Once you alight at Fair Park Station, the pavilion is roughly a 5-10 minute walk, making it very accessible.

By Bus: Several Dallas Area Rapid Transit (DART) bus routes serve the Fair Park area. Routes such as the 3, 10, and 19 typically have stops in or around Fair Park. It’s advisable to check the latest DART schedules and route maps closer to the date of the concert, as service can be adjusted for major events. Key stops will be within easy walking distance of the pavilion.

By Car: Driving to Dos Equis Pavilion is an option, but parking within Fair Park can be limited and subject to significant demand on concert nights. Several parking lots are available within the park, but it's wise to pre-purchase parking passes if available or be prepared for potentially long queues and higher parking fees. Factor in extra time for traffic congestion around the venue, especially on event days.
